Stroke after piercing barbed wire injury: a time for introspection
Rajendra Singh Jain1, Rakesh Agrawal1, Sunil Kumar1
1Department of Neurology, S.M.S. Medical College, Jaipur, Rajasthan, India.
Summary
Traumatic internal carotid artery dissection is a rare injury, often overlooked after trauma. This case highlights an unusual cause: barbed wire injury leading to stroke in veterinary personnel.

Background:
- Traumatic internal carotid artery (ICA) dissection is an uncommon but serious consequence of neck trauma.
- It can lead to significant morbidity and mortality, often resulting from direct blows or extreme neck movements.
- While sports injuries are rarely implicated, other mechanisms are possible.

A hemorrhagic stroke develops when a cerebral blood vessel ruptures, allowing blood to escape into the surrounding brain tissue, as in intracerebral hemorrhage (ICH), or into the subarachnoid space, as in subarachnoid hemorrhage (SAH). Burn injuries occur when the skin and underlying tissues are damaged due to exposure to heat, electricity, chemicals, radiation, or friction. They can vary in severity, from minor superficial burns to severe deep burns that can be life-threatening.
